SCI Annual Hunters' Convention
February 5th - 8th, 2014
Las Vegas, Nevada
Headquarters Hotel: Mandalay Bay Hotel & Casino
January 14th - 17th, 2015
Reno, Nevada
Headquarters Hotel: Peppermill Resort & Casino
February 3rd - 6th, 2016
Las Vegas, Nevada
Headquarters Hotel: Mandalay Bay Hotel & Casino
February 1st - 4th, 2017
Las Vegas, Nevada
Headquarters Hotel: Mandalay Bay Hotel & Casino
